Model: SealMiner A3 Pro Hydro
Hlavní vodou chlazený těžař Bitcoinů od společnosti Bitdeer s výkonem 660 TH/s SHA-256, příkonem 8 250 W a efektivitou 12,5 J/TH. Nejvyšší třída v rodině SealMiner A3 Pro, používající vlastní čip SEAL02 od společnosti Bitdeer vyráběný ve spolupráci s TSMC. Skříň v racku 2U s rozměry 482 x 665 x 86 mm a hmotností 20,5 kg. Průmyslové napájení 380 až 480 V třífázové s širší tolerancí napětí než běžný ASIC hardware. Provozní teplota od 20 do 55 stupňů Celsia (širší tepelné tolerance než většina konkurenčního vodního hardware). Hluk skříně při provozu 50 dB, s externím uzavřeným okruhem vodního chlazení. Oznámeno v říjnu 2025, s dodávkami od ledna 2026. Tolerance výkonu ±3 % (skutečný výstup 640 až 680 TH/s), tolerance spotřeby ±5 %. Bitdeer je kótován na NASDAQ (ticker BTDR) s vertikální integrací od návrhu čipů po velkokapacitní těžební operace, což přináší podnikatelskou důvěryhodnost odlišnou od běžných čínských výrobců ASIC. 10 zařízení na 42U rack produkuje celkově 6,6 PH/s při spotřebě 82,5 kW na rack. 660 TH/s of SHA-256 hashrate at 8,250W continuous power draw and 12.5 J/TH efficiency. Bitdeer's ±3% hashrate tolerance means real world output ranges 640 to 680 TH/s. ±5% power tolerance. This is the top bin of Bitdeer's SealMiner A3 family, positioned above the A3 Hydro 500TH standard bin (13.5 J/TH) and matching the A3 Pro Air 290TH efficiency (12.5 J/TH in air cooled format).
SEAL02 je vlastnictvím Bitdeer proprietární čip ASIC založený na SHA-256, který je vyráběn ve spolupráci s TSMC (Taiwan Semiconductor Manufacturing Company). To představuje důležitou technickou investici do návrhu čipů, nikoliv licenci na silikon od Bitmain nebo MicroBT. Čip SEAL02 dosahuje účinnosti 12,5 J/TH jak u varianty se vzdušným chlazením, tak u varianty s hydrochlazením SealMiner. Vertikální integrace Bitdeeru od návrhu čipů přes výrobu těžebního hardwaru až po průmyslové těžení bitcoinu vytváří sladěné incentivy pro spolehlivost hardwaru a dlouhodobou podporu.
Bitdeer Technologies Holding Co trades on NASDAQ under ticker BTDR as a US publicly listed company. This brings regulatory compliance, financial transparency, and long term product commitment comparable to Block's Proto mining hardware venture rather than typical opaque Chinese ASIC manufacturers. Bitdeer operates vertical integration across chip design (SEAL02 silicon through TSMC partnership), hardware manufacturing (SealMiner series), and industrial Bitcoin mining operations at scale. Deploying SealMiner hardware in Bitdeer's own mining operations provides aligned incentives distinct from hardware only companies with no operational mining exposure.
External closed loop water cooling system with standard industrial components. Each unit generates approximately 8.25 kW thermal load (28,150 BTU per hour), requiring circulation pumps sized for fleet flow rate, dry cooler or water to water heat exchanger rated for total thermal load, inline particulate filtration, automated flow monitoring, and temperature management. Same infrastructure tier as competing hydro hardware in the 8 to 12 kW per unit thermal output range. Standard 19 inch rack deployment with water manifold distribution. No immersion tanks, no dielectric fluid, no custom tank infrastructure.
380 to 480V three phase industrial power, with broader voltage tolerance than typical competing ASIC hardware (most specify 380 to 415V range). At 480V three phase: approximately 10 amps per phase continuous. At 415V: approximately 11 amps per phase. At 380V: approximately 13 amps per phase. Fits standard 16 amp three phase breakers at any voltage within range. The 480V support enables direct North American industrial service compatibility without step down transformers. Bin tier differentiation across the same chassis platform. A3 Pro Hydro (this product): 660 TH/s at 8,250W and 12.5 J/TH (top bin). A3 Hydro: 500 TH/s at 6,750W and 13.5 J/TH (standard bin). Both units share identical 2U chassis, cooling architecture, power infrastructure requirements, and Bitdeer firmware. Top bin SEAL02 silicon runs at higher clock frequencies producing 32 percent more hashrate from identical chassis at 8 percent better efficiency. The acquisition premium for top bin typically runs $2,000 to $3,500 per unit. Economic math favors top bin at industrial hosting rates below $0.05 per kWh on 3 year deployments. At higher electricity rates or shorter horizons, the value case narrows.
Efficiency and corporate positioning comparison. A3 Pro Hydro (this product): 660 TH/s at 8,250W and 12.5 J/TH on proprietary SEAL02 silicon, 2U rack format, Bitdeer (NASDAQ BTDR). S23 Hydro 580TH: 580 TH/s at 5,510W and 9.5 J/TH on Bitmain silicon, compact standalone format. The S23 Hydro delivers 24 percent better efficiency (9.5 versus 12.5 J/TH) at lower power draw per unit but at approximately 35 percent higher acquisition cost. At $0.07 per kWh industrial rates over 3 year deployment, the S23 Hydro efficiency savings offset the acquisition premium. The A3 Pro Hydro wins on rack format flexibility (2U versus standalone), corporate credibility through NASDAQ listing, and broader voltage tolerance (380 to 480V versus 380 to 415V).

No. The 380 to 480V three phase power requirement excludes residential electrical service in most regions. The 8.25 kW thermal load requires substantial external water cooling infrastructure impractical for residential installation. The 20.5 kg weight and 665 mm depth require standard 19 inch server rack hardware. This is strictly industrial hardware for professional mining facilities and commercial data centers. For home deployment, Bitmain S21+ Hydro 395TH with universal 100 to 240V single phase voltage represents the residential hydro ceiling.
10 units per 42U rack produce 6.6 PH/s aggregate at 82.5 kW per rack. 100 kW industrial panel supports approximately 12 units producing 7.92 PH/s aggregate. Compare alternatives at 100 kW. 12 A3 Pro Hydro units: 7.92 PH/s. 9 S23 Hyd 3U units: 10.44 PH/s (newer generation, 32 percent more aggregate). 18 S21 XP+ Hyd 500TH units: 9.0 PH/s (compact format, 14 percent more aggregate). The A3 Pro Hydro positions mid tier on aggregate hashrate per kilowatt at current generation efficiency.
20 to 55 degrees Celsius ambient operating range, broader thermal headroom than most competing hydro hardware (most specify 5 to 45 or 20 to 50 degrees Celsius). The 55 degree upper limit supports deployment in warmer climate facilities without aggressive cooling overprovisioning. 10 to 90 percent humidity range accommodates typical data center and industrial mining facility conditions. This wider thermal tolerance represents a meaningful deployment advantage in hot climates (Middle East, Southeast Asia, southern US, Australia) where facility ambient temperatures can exceed 40 degrees during summer operation.
Industrial deployment with three phase power and hydro cooling infrastructure. Step one: install dedicated 380 to 480V three phase electrical service with appropriate breaker capacity. Step two: install and commission external hydro cooling loop with pumps, plumbing, coolant fill, dry cooler infrastructure, and temperature monitoring. Step three: 2U rack mount the A3 Pro Hydro units in standard 19 inch server racks. Connect water inlet/outlet fittings to manifold system with individual isolation valves. Verify zero leaks before energizing. Step four: connect three phase power cables and Ethernet management. Step five: power on, allow coolant flow to stabilize, find miner IP through DHCP, open Bitdeer management interface, configure pool URL and Bitcoin wallet, verify hashrate reaches 640+ TH/s within 15 to 20 minutes per unit.
Standard hydro cooling maintenance. Weekly visual inspection of water fittings for leaks or corrosion. Monthly coolant quality testing (pH within spec, particulate levels minimal). Every 12 to 24 months full coolant replacement depending on fluid chemistry. Quarterly pump and dry cooler inspection including flow rate verification. Inline filter replacement when pressure differential exceeds specification. Hashboard failure rates on hydro units run meaningfully lower than air cooled equivalents because chips operate at consistent temperatures. Bitdeer firmware provides monitoring tools shared across all A3 SealMiner models. Budget 3 to 5 percent of acquisition cost annually for maintenance reserves.
Any SHA-256 proof of work cryptocurrency. Bitcoin (BTC) is the primary target. Other compatible coins include Bitcoin Cash (BCH), Bitcoin SV (BSV), Fractal Bitcoin (FB), Namecoin (NMC), DigiByte (DGB SHA-256 chain). Merged mining BTC alongside BCH and BSV through supporting pools (ViaBTC, F2Pool) adds marginal secondary revenue without reducing Bitcoin hashrate contribution.

Any Stratum compatible Bitcoin pool. Foundry USA leads by network hashrate share. F2Pool has the longest operational track record. AntPool remains popular despite Bitdeer branding. ViaBTC offers accumulation mode payouts. Luxor supports hashrate derivatives products. Bitdeer operates its own mining pool (Bitdeer Pool) with SealMiner hardware optimization, typically offering competitive pool fees for vertical integration benefits. For fleet deployments above 7 PH/s (equivalent to 10+ units), direct negotiated agreements with major pools typically secure reduced fees.
CapEx beyond miner acquisition: three phase electrical service installation ($5,000 to $20,000 per facility), hydro cooling loop and dry cooler infrastructure ($5,000 to $25,000 per rack depending on capacity), standard 19 inch rack hardware ($1,500 to $4,000 per rack). Annual OpEx per unit at 8.25 kW continuous: electricity at $5,783 at $0.08 per kWh, $5,060 at $0.07 per kWh, $2,891 at $0.04 per kWh industrial hosting rates. Water glycol coolant maintenance ($100 to $200 annually per unit). Spare parts reserves. 3 year TCO per unit at $0.07 per kWh self hosted: approximately $10,449 hardware plus $15,180 electricity plus $1,200 maintenance equals $26,829 total. 3 year gross revenue at $0.07 per kWh profitability: $9,000 to $14,000.
